88pm860x_battery: Eliminate possible references to released resources

Author: Julia Lawall <julia.lawall@lip6.fr>

devm_kzalloc should not be followed by kfree, as this results in a double
free.  The problem was found using the following semantic match
(http://coccinelle.lip6.fr/):

// 
@@
expression x,e;
@@
x = devm_kzalloc(...)
... when != x = e
?-kfree(x,...);
// 

Furthermore, in the remove function, the calls to free_irq are moved up to
prevent a possible reference in the interrupt handler to resources freed by
power_supply_unregister.
